1. Key Music Production Trends in 2025
AI-Powered Music Tools
The integration of Artificial Intelligence (AI) in music production has skyrocketed in recent years. In 2025, AI tools are helping producers generate melodies, harmonies, and even entire tracks with minimal input. AI platforms like Amper Music and Aiva can assist in everything from sound design to mastering, speeding up the creative process. However, while AI is making waves, it is still vital to blend human creativity with these tools to preserve the emotional depth that music needs.Immersive Audio Experiences: 3D and Spatial Audio
With streaming platforms like Spotify and Apple Music investing in spatial audio technologies, producers are increasingly experimenting with 3D soundscapes. This trend is especially relevant for genres like electronic, ambient, and cinematic music. Tools like Dolby Atmos and Apple’s Spatial Audio are enabling more immersive listening experiences. If you want to keep up, now’s the time to start learning about binaural mixing techniques and how to implement 3D sound into your productions.Live Looping and Interactive Performance
Live looping has been a cornerstone of electronic music performance, but in 2025, it's entering new territory with advanced MIDI controllers and live-production software. Whether you’re performing live on stage or in the studio, this interactive approach is not only engaging for listeners but also offers endless creative possibilities. Producers are exploring hardware like Ableton Push and software like Serato Sample to loop and manipulate sounds in real-time.
2. Must-Have Music Production Tools for 2025
Digital Audio Workstations (DAWs)
A solid DAW is the backbone of any music production setup. In 2025, producers are still relying on top DAWs like Ableton Live, FL Studio, Logic Pro X, and Pro Tools. Ableton Live is particularly popular for electronic and experimental genres due to its powerful session view and live performance capabilities. Logic Pro X remains a go-to for its intuitive interface and large library of plugins, while FL Studio continues to be favored by many hip-hop producers.VST Plugins and Sound Libraries
To create unique and professional-grade soundscapes, producers need a wide range of VST plugins. For sound design, Omnisphere 2 by Spectrasonics and Serum by Xfer Records remain industry standards, while U-He Diva and Valhalla DSP offer top-notch reverb and delay effects. Make sure your library is stocked with diverse sounds, from classical orchestral instruments to the latest experimental synths.Hardware: MIDI Controllers and Audio Interfaces
While software has come a long way, hardware still plays an essential role in music production. A good MIDI controller can make a huge difference in how you interact with your DAW. Controllers like Native Instruments Komplete Kontrol and Novation Launchkey provide tactile control, allowing you to manipulate sounds with ease. Additionally, a high-quality audio interface, such as the Focusrite Scarlett or Universal Audio Apollo, ensures that your recordings are crisp, clear, and professional.
3. Music Production Techniques to Master in 2025
Advanced Sound Design
The world of sound design continues to expand, with new synthesis techniques and tools pushing the boundaries of what's possible. 2025 is the perfect year to experiment with granular synthesis, FM synthesis, and wavetable synthesis to create complex, evolving sounds. Tools like Arturia Pigments and Xfer Serum allow you to create everything from lush pads to aggressive basslines.Mixing with Atmosphere and Space
Mixing is one of the most critical aspects of music production, and in 2025, it's all about creating atmosphere. Producers are focusing on adding depth to their tracks by working with reverb, delay, and stereo panning. Techniques like sidechain compression and mid-side processing are helping to create more dynamic and immersive mixes. For 3D audio, consider exploring Ambisonic techniques to expand your sonic field further.Mastering for Multiple Platforms
As streaming platforms continue to grow, it’s essential to master your tracks with a focus on how they will sound across different devices, from high-end speakers to smartphones. Tools like iZotope Ozone can help you optimize your tracks for streaming services, ensuring your music sounds balanced, punchy, and clear no matter where it’s being played.
4. The Role of Collaboration in Modern Music Production
With the rise of online collaboration platforms, remote work has become a common practice in the music industry. Tools like Splice, Airtable, and Google Drive make it easier than ever to share project files, collaborate with producers worldwide, and receive feedback. Whether you’re working with a vocalist across the globe or a producer down the street, remote collaboration is making music production more inclusive and accessible.
